Is data science related to operations research?

Is data science related to operations research?

Operations Research and Data science are closely related because OR algorithms are also applied on real world data. If operations research is the metal detector that guides to the right area of business then data science is the spade to dig into the data and extract value.

What is the difference between operations research and data science?

Operation research is a scientific approach to solve problems using mathematical sciences while data science is used to visualize the present and predict the future using data.

What is Operation Research Analyst?

Operations research analysts are high-level problem-solvers who use advanced techniques, such as optimization, data mining, statistical analysis and mathematical modeling, to develop solutions that help businesses and organizations operate more efficiently and cost-effectively.

Is research analyst same as financial analyst?

Financial analysts examine, collect, and interpret financial information to help companies make business decisions. A research analyst is someone who typically performs investigative analysis, which can involve finding financial information, examining, interpreting, and reporting on the data collected.

What degree does an operations research analyst need?

How to Become an Operations Research Analyst. Analysts typically have a degree in business, operations research, management science, analytics, mathematics, engineering, computer science, or another technical or quantitative field.

Why did the Air Force change the role of Operations Research Analyst?

The change, which went into effect April 30, reflects the broader shift across the Air Force on the importance of information and data. It also brings direct influence on talent management, improved training and resource optimization for the career field, which consists of approximately 550 military operations research analysts.

What does a research analyst do in the military?

The analysts are data science experts who provide recommendations to commanders and decision-makers at all levels, across a wide range of functional areas. Under the change, all total force operations research analyst officers convert from 61A to the newly created 15A AFSC.
